Roof Installation Process in Milwaukee

1

Free On-Site Inspection

A licensed Milwaukee roofer visits your property to measure the roof, inspect the deck, assess ventilation, and provide a detailed written estimate tailored to WI building codes.

2

Material Selection

Choose from materials rated for extreme cold, lake-effect snow, and ice buildup. Your contractor recommends options based on your budget, aesthetic preference, and the specific demands of Milwaukee's climate.

3

Old Roof Removal

The crew strips existing roofing down to the deck, inspecting for hidden water damage. In Milwaukee, deterioration from extreme cold, lake-effect snow, and ice buildup is often found beneath the surface.

4

Deck Repair & Preparation

Rotted or damaged decking is replaced. Ice and water shield, synthetic underlayment, and drip edge are installed per WI code requirements for Milwaukee's climate zone.

5

New Roof Installation

Your new roofing material is installed with proper overlap, flashing, and ventilation. Every detail is executed to manufacturer specifications and Milwaukee building standards.

6

Final Inspection & Cleanup

The crew performs quality checks, magnetic nail sweeps, and a thorough cleanup. You receive warranty documentation and before-and-after photos of your Milwaukee home's new roof.

How long does a new roof last?

Roof lifespan in Milwaukee depends on the material: asphalt shingles last 20–30 years, metal roofing 40–70 years, and tile 50–100 years. Exposure to extreme cold, lake-effect snow, and ice buildup can shorten or extend these ranges based on maintenance.

What are signs I need a new roof?

In Milwaukee, watch for curling shingles, granule loss in gutters, daylight through the attic, water stains on ceilings, and flashing deterioration. Damage from extreme cold, lake-effect snow, and ice buildup accelerates these signs.
